Surface Coating Strategies for Ensuring Efficiency in Success

Efficiency is the lifeblood of any successful surface coating operation. Whether you’re dealing with powder coating, liquid painting, or any other coating method, the ability to deliver high-quality results while minimizing waste and reducing costs is paramount. Surface coatings encompass paints, powder coatings, drying oils, varnishes, and synthetic clear coatings. These coatings primarily serve to safeguard an object’s surface from environmental factors. Surface coating strategies for ensuring efficiency.

Streamline Your Processes

Efficiency starts with well-defined and streamlined surface coating processes. Map out each step of your coating operation, identify bottlenecks, and eliminate unnecessary steps. This process optimization can significantly improve overall efficiency.

Invest in Modern Equipment

Up-to-date equipment can make a world of difference. Newer technologies often come with features that enhance efficiency, such as precision controls, automated systems, and energy-saving mechanisms.

Proper Training and Skill Development

A well-trained workforce is essential. Invest in continuous training and skill development for your operators. Skilled workers can operate equipment more efficiently, reduce errors and troubleshoot problems effectively.

Material Management

Efficient material usage is crucial. Implement inventory management systems to monitor and control material consumption. Avoid over-ordering or under-utilizing materials, which can lead to unnecessary costs and waste.

Quality Control Measures

Implement robust quality control processes. Detecting and addressing defects early in the surface coating process reduces rework, saving time and materials.

Energy Efficiency

Consider energy-efficient equipment and practices. LED lighting, low-energy curing methods and improved insulation in coating booths can reduce energy consumption and costs.

Waste Reduction

Minimize waste generation by using advanced application techniques and recovery systems. Powder recycling and solvent recovery systems, for example, can significantly reduce waste.

Regular Maintenance

Preventive maintenance is crucial to keep equipment running at peak efficiency. Develop a maintenance schedule and conduct regular inspections to catch and address issues before they lead to downtime.

Data Analytics

Leverage data analytics to gain insights into your coating processes. Analyzing data can help you identify trends, troubleshoot problems, and make informed decisions to enhance efficiency.

Continuous Improvement Culture

Encourage a culture of continuous improvement among your team. Encourage employees to suggest ideas for efficiency enhancements and recognize and reward contributions to the process.

Efficiency in surface coating is not a one-time achievement but an ongoing commitment. By streamlining processes, investing in technology, training your workforce, and adopting sustainable practices, you can create a more efficient and profitable surface coating operation. Efficiency not only improves your bottom line but also enhances your competitiveness in the industry.
